Is Ladora a Good Place to Live?
Economy & Jobs
Ladora residents earn a median household income of $61,250 , which is 18%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$26,795. The unemployment rate stands at 3.0% (17%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 11.6%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 708 business establishments, including 40 restaurants.
Housing & Cost of Living
The median home value in Ladora is $81,900 , 71%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$163,074. Median rent is $492/month, with 18.8%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 87.8 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1938.
Safety & Crime
Ladora reports 199 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 48%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 239/100K.
Education
9.7% of adults in Ladora hold a bachelor's degree or higher (71% below the national average). 94.9% have completed high school. Local schools score 6.0/10 in standardized testing.
Climate & Weather
Ladora has an average annual temperature of 48°F (9°C). Winters average 19°F in January while summers reach 73°F in July. The area gets 275 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 36.0 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43.
